| Description | And the CD82 overexpression can suppress tumor invasiveness and metastatic potential by inducing MMP9 inactivation via upregulation of TIMP1, Expression of this gene has been shown to be downregulated in tumor progression of human cancers and can be activated by p53 through a consensus binding sequence in the promoter, The expression of CD82 protein appears to be correlated with lymph node metastasis in esophageal squamous cell carcinoma(ESCC), The gene is mapped to 11p11, This metastasis suppressor gene product is a membrane glycoprotein that is a member of the transmembrane 4 superfamily, also named KAI1, is a human protein encoded by the CD82 gene, 2, CD82(Cluster of Differentiation 82) |
